HENFALLET HOLDING AS is registered as a limited company in Tydal, Trøndelag with organisation number 911915197. The business is classified under other captive investment companies (NACE 64.323). The company was incorporated in 2013. Registered share capital is NOK 30,000, divided into 30 shares. The company's stated purpose is: “Kjøp og salg av aksjer, samt drive konsulentvirksomhet. Herunder å delta i andre selskap med lignende virksomhet eller på annen måte gjøre seg interessert i andre foretagender.”.
